Adaptive wavelet simulation of weakly compressible flow in a channel with a suddenly expanded section

We present an adaptive multiresolution simulation method for computing weakly compressible flow bounded by solid walls of arbitrary shape, using a finite volume (FV) approach coupled with wavelets for grid adaptation. A volume penalization method is employed to compute...
